Crystal, I turn my own eggs here from day 1. On shipped though, I wait for about 3-5 days before they go in the turner. My original Seramas were from Beth & Rachael's shipped eggs and they all hatched beautifully. I really think the humidity is a big issue with these little bitty eggs, they drown a lot easier than the bigger eggs.

x 2 on the humidity... I dry incubate. Lock down 50-ish %
 
Good to know. I am dry incubating everything now because I have had horrible hatches recently. Chicks fully develop and don't externally pip, or they pip and then don't zip. Our humidity down here runs so high anyway that I think the external air is high enough until lockdown.
